-// compile-flags: -Zdrop-tracking
-#![feature(generators, negative_impls, rustc_attrs)]
-
-macro_rules! type_combinations {
-    (
-        $( $name:ident => { $( $tt:tt )* } );* $(;)?
-    ) => { $(
-        mod $name {
-            $( $tt )*
-
-            impl !Sync for Client {}
-            impl !Send for Client {}
-        }
-
-        // Struct update syntax. This fails because the Client used in the update is considered
-        // dropped *after* the yield.
-        {
-            let g = move || match drop($name::Client { ..$name::Client::default() }) {
-            //~^ `significant_drop::Client` which is not `Send`
-            //~| `insignificant_dtor::Client` which is not `Send`
-            //~| `derived_drop::Client` which is not `Send`
-                _ => yield,
-            };
-            assert_send(g);
-            //~^ ERROR cannot be sent between threads
-            //~| ERROR cannot be sent between threads
-            //~| ERROR cannot be sent between threads
-        }
-
-        // Simple owned value. This works because the Client is considered moved into `drop`,
-        // even though the temporary expression doesn't end until after the yield.
-        {
-            let g = move || match drop($name::Client::default()) {
-                _ => yield,
-            };
-            assert_send(g);
-        }
-    )* }
-}
-
-fn assert_send<T: Send>(_thing: T) {}
-
-fn main() {
-    type_combinations!(
-        // OK
-        copy => { #[derive(Copy, Clone, Default)] pub struct Client; };
-        // NOT OK: MIR borrowck thinks that this is used after the yield, even though
-        // this has no `Drop` impl and only the drops of the fields are observable.
-        // FIXME: this should compile.
-        derived_drop => { #[derive(Default)] pub struct Client { pub nickname: String } };
-        // NOT OK
-        significant_drop => {
-            #[derive(Default)]
-            pub struct Client;
-            impl Drop for Client {
-                fn drop(&mut self) {}
-            }
-        };
-        // NOT OK (we need to agree with MIR borrowck)
-        insignificant_dtor => {
-            #[derive(Default)]
-            #[rustc_insignificant_dtor]
-            pub struct Client;
-            impl Drop for Client {
-                fn drop(&mut self) {}
-            }
-        };
-    );
-}
